Jennifer Carwile
Jennifer Carwile (Democratic Party) ran for election to the Baton Rouge Metro Council to represent District 11 in Louisiana. Carwile did not appear on the ballot for the primary on November 3, 2020.

Louisiana elections use the majority-vote system. All candidates compete in the same primary, and a candidate can win the election outright by receiving more than 50 percent of the vote. If no candidate does, the top two vote recipients from the primary advance to the general election, regardless of their partisan affiliation.

Nonpartisan primary for East Baton Rouge Metro Council District 11
Laura White Adams won election outright against Gordon Bargas and Jonathan Snyder in the primary for East Baton Rouge Metro Council District 11 on November 3, 2020.
